Practice awareness

Shame is a pervasive feeling that we cannot avoid, but it can be reprocessed and transformed through techniques that interrupt the pattern. The first step to healing shame is to witness it. In your journal, identify which of the five shame responses—attacking others, attacking yourself, denying, fawning, or withdrawing—you most commonly use. Then, throughout the next few days, lovingly and compassionately notice when something triggers you into one of those responses. Since you’ve already identified your triggers and their underlying emotions, this exercise is about looking more closely at which of those emotions are disguising shame, such as fear of rejection, feeling unsafe, or feeling unworthy, unlovable, or inadequate. Some common beliefs tied to shame can be I’m useless, I’m a failure, I don’t deserve anything good, and on and on. Your willingness to recognize the patterns and be inquisitive about shame is an act of self-respect. You cannot heal what you’re unwilling to see.

Even though I couldn’t recognize or admit the shame at first, I would commonly say, “No one can take care of me. I have to fix it all myself.” Recognizing my two most common shame responses helped me see how the feeling of being out of control triggered childhood memories of being neglected and expected to take care of myself. Unpacking this pattern further, I noticed that when I felt out of control I also felt helpless and unsafe—but ashamed that I couldn’t do anything about it.
